Transaction 9004262a8325af99bf4b2312a83a839f2b91889d449d4663f5f4b78b9fdaec85
1 Input
1 Output
-
9004262a8325af99bf4b2312a83a839f2b91889d449d4663f5f4b78b9fdaec85:0
- value
- 3085
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f026d7c05f5fa21031cc56e5e66c93f48a1c0f08 OP_EQUAL
- address
- 3PapdRhYW6VW7Bgve75nABVgw4BgFDuy17